First Game in a While


I am please to be releasing an early, Work-in-Progress build of a small game I have been working on in my spare time. It is tough to find time these days to make games, however I am happy to be developing again.

It has been some time since working on a game, and as this is an early build, I would love to hear any feedback and criticisms of anyone who gives it a go. There is not yet a whole lot of content as of yet, as most of the time developing was getting some simple sprites in to start developing, and making the gameplay (in particular the controls) feel good.

Controller support has been tested with only an Xbox360 controller so far, however the game feels great to play with a gamepad, and I would encourage anyone able to do so.

Please feel free to message me any problems you encounter. If there is any interest in the game, I may update the game here with another early release build in the future.
